"""Tests for the MongoDB shell. | ||
Right now these mostly just test that the shell handles command line arguments | ||
appropriately. | ||
""" | ||
|
||
import unittest | ||
import sys | ||
import subprocess | ||
import os | ||
|
||
"""Exit codes for MongoDB.""" | ||
BADOPTS = 2 | ||
BADHOST = 14 | ||
NOCONNECT = 255 | ||
|
||
"""Path to the mongo shell executable to be tested.""" | ||
mongo_path = None | ||
|
||
class TestShell(unittest.TestCase): | ||
|
||
def open_mongo(self, args=[]): | ||
"""Get a subprocess.Popen instance of the shell with the given args. | ||
""" | ||
return subprocess.Popen([mongo_path] + args, | ||
stdin=subprocess.PIPE, | ||
stdout=subprocess.PIPE, | ||
stderr = subprocess.PIPE) | ||
|
||
def setUp(self): | ||
assert mongo_path | ||
|
||
def test_help(self): | ||
mongo_h = self.open_mongo(["-h"]) | ||
mongo_help = self.open_mongo(["--help"]) | ||
|
||
out = mongo_h.communicate() | ||
self.assertEqual(out, mongo_help.communicate()) | ||
self.assert_(out[0].startswith("usage:")) | ||
|
||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o_h.returncode) |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o_help.returncode) | ||
|
||
def test_nodb(self): | ||
mongo = self.open_mongo([]) | ||
mongo_nodb = self.open_mongo(["--nodb"]) | ||
|
||
out = mongo_nodb.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("MongoDB shell version"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("couldn't connect" not in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o_nodb.returncode) | ||
|
||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("MongoDB shell version"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" not in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("couldn't connect"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
def test_eval(self): | ||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--nodb", "--eval", "print('hello world');"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("hello world"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" not in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--eval"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("required parameter is missing"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(BADOPTS,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
def test_shell(self): | ||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--nodb", "--shell", "--eval", "print('hello world');"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("hello world"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" in out[0]) # the shell started and immediately exited because stdin was empty |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
def test_host_port(self): | ||
mongo = self.open_mongo([]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--host", "localhost"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: localhost/test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--port", "27018"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: 127.0.0.1:27018"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--host", "localhost", "--port", "27018"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: localhost:27018/test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--host"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("required parameter is missing"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(BADOPTS,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--port"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("required parameter is missing"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(BADOPTS,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
def test_positionals(self): | ||
dirname = os.path.dirname(__file__) | ||
test_js = os.path.join(dirname, "testdata/test.js") | ||
test_txt = os.path.join(dirname, "testdata/test.txt") | ||
test = os.path.join(dirname, "testdata/test") | ||
non_exist_js = os.path.join(dirname, "testdata/nonexist.js") | ||
non_exist_txt = os.path.join(dirname, "testdata/nonexist.txt") |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--nodb", test_js]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("hello world"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" not in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--nodb", test_txt]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("foobar"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" not in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o([test_js, test, test_txt]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o([test_txt, test, test_js]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o([test, test_js, test_txt]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: " + test in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: " + test in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(BADHOST,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o([non_exist_js, test, test_txt]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: test"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o([non_exist_txt, test_js, test_txt]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("url: " + non_exist_txt in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("connecting to: " + non_exist_txt in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(BADHOST,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
def test_multiple_files(self): | ||
dirname = os.path.dirname(__file__) | ||
test_js = os.path.join(dirname, "testdata/test.js") | ||
test_txt = os.path.join(dirname, "testdata/test.txt") |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--nodb", test_js, test_txt]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("hello world"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("foobar"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" not in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--shell", "--nodb", test_js, test_txt]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("hello world"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("foobar" in out[0]) | ||
self.assert_("bye"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(0,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
# just testing that they don't blow up | ||
def test_username_and_password(self): | ||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--username", "mike"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["-u", "mike"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--password", "mike"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["-p", "mike"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assertEqual(NOCONNECT,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--username"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("required parameter is missing"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(BADOPTS,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
mongo = self.open_mongo(["--password"]) | ||
out = mongo.communicate() | ||
self.assert_("required parameter is missing" in out[0]) | ||
self.assertEqual(BADOPTS, mongo.returncode) | ||
|
||
|
||
if __name__ == "__main__": | ||
if len(sys.argv) != 2: | ||
print "must give the path to shell executable to be tested" | ||
sys.exit() | ||
|
||
mongo_path = sys.argv[1] | ||
|
||
suite = unittest.TestLoader().loadTestsFromTestCase(TestShell) | ||
unittest.TextTestRunner(verbosity=1).run(suite) |
